

Here’s a full recipe for a Delicious, Crispy Plate of Seasonal Vegetables and Roots — a vibrant, wholesome dish that celebrates texture and flavor:
🥕 Ingredients (Serves 4–6)
- 2 medium carrots, peeled and cut into sticks
- 2 parsnips, peeled and cut into sticks
- 2 medium sweet potatoes, cubed
- 1 small butternut squash, cubed
- 1 red onion, cut into wedges
- 1 cup Brussels sprouts, halved
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 2 tbsp melted butter
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p smoked paprika
- ½ tsp dried thyme
- ½ tsp rosemary
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
-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
- Optional: lemon wedges or balsamic glaze for serving
🍳 Instructions
- Preheat the oven
- Set oven to 425°F (220°C).
-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cleanup.
- Season the vegetables
- In a large mixing bowl, combine all the prepared vegetables.
- Drizzle with olive oil and melted butter.
- Add garlic powder, paprika, thyme, rosemary, salt, and pepper.
- Toss until everything is evenly coated.
- Roast until golden and crisp
- Spread vegetables in a single layer on the baking sheet (avoid overcrowding).
- Roast for 25–30 minutes, flipping halfway through.
- They should be tender inside and beautifully crisp on the edges.
- Finish and serve
- Transfer to a serving platter.
- Garnish with chopped parsley.
- Serve hot with lemon wedges or a drizzle of balsamic glaze for brightness.
🌟 Tips & Variations
- Extra crunch: Sprinkle panko breadcrumbs during the last 10 minutes of roasting.
- Sweet twist: Add a drizzle of honey or maple syrup before serving.
- Spicy version: Toss with chili flakes or cayenne for heat.
- Seasonal swaps: Try beets, turnips, or asparagus depending on what’s fresh.
